The Willet is a common bird with a curious migratory behavior. In summer, the Western subspecies lives inland in grassy wetlands and dry meadows of the Northwest, while the Eastern subspecies lives in the salt marshes and beaches of the east coast. In winter the Western Willet becomes a shore bird along the Pacific, Gulf and Atlantic coasts, and the Eastern leaves North America entirely.
